Love the vintage look and feel of things that bring you back to yesterday and wish that your children’s clothes could have that same flair? Well, MoM of 3, Diane from Texas has been working My Vintage Baby since 2009 as direct sales representative to share with others, clothes that have that one of kind look. She started with the company as a way to get involved in their fun trunk shows, and to find an opportunity to be a direct sales representative. The business actually started in 2003 by MoM, Jessica who began creating unique clothes for her daughter turning ordinary clothes into something fabulous. Many of the collections are inspired from vintage materials creating a one-of-a-kind look. she uses reproduction feed sacks, hankies, chenille, aprons, and tablecloths to embellish the clothing, creating truly unique designs. Their vision is to make each garment as unique as the children who wear them! My Vintage Baby also has lots of ideas that fall outside the vintage look. They now offer several other collections each season that are not of vintage inspiration; but rather created with a little funk, a lot of glitz, and a fresh new look. Creating special clothing for special girls and boys is what these lifestyle collections are all about.
